Fred Fraser Jr., KB1CDJ
of Moultonborough, New Hampshire, passed away on Wednesday, October 22, 2014 at the VA Hospital in Manchester, New Hampshire. He was 79 years old. He is survived by his son Fred Fraser III, residing in Maine.
Fred was born on February 11, 1935 in Haverhill, Massachusetts.
Freddy, as he was known to his friends served in the United States Navy from 1952 to 1955.
He was well known throughout the Lakes Region for his quick wit and friendly nature. He was the epitome of a welcome wagon to all new hams. He made sure you felt comfortable and knew everyone as if they were old friends.
Despite losing a leg in a motorcycle accident many years ago, he continued to ride a motorcycle well into his 70’s. It never deterred him from doing what he loved.
